Description

Reeds and Hogans, two of Masonic Home's longest if not strongest, athletic families. Jimmy Reed, 17, currently rules the Reed roost at Masonic Home. He graduates this spring, Jimmy owns three football letters, three basketball letters, two baseball letters and three tracks letters. Lots to Mail. Jimmy scored two straight knockouts in the regional Golden Gloves tournament this year before he was forced to default because of an injured hand. He was in the high school division. Published in Fort Worth Star-Telegram evening edition March 1, 1950.
